你查询的IP:[121.51.45.2]  地理位置:中国–上海–上海

最新查询121.4.9.44 116.52.76.36 119.3.166.115 166.111.151.68 202.96.96.201 58.240.157.30 124.16.167.101 117.40.84.2 122.86.64.76 121.51.45.2 116.214.32.179 220.231.128.189 118.178.115.153 202.127.252.156 222.32.139.67 202.127.212.69 117.21.38.7 123.101.55.236 202.69.4.244 59.80.13.33 202.122.32.36 116.56.18.155 202.122.32.23 222.176.26.185 202.38.158.152 125.210.200.146 119.18.224.69 210.14.128.181 124.72.135.116 122.200.64.56 122.102.24.12